2018 Budget: Whistle blowing lines still open – Buhari warns

President Muhammadu Buhari on Tuesday told the members of the joint National Assembly that the whistle-blowing lines were still open.
The warning was handled down to looters and anyone habouring the intention to steal from the nation’s treasury.
Buhari said this during his budget presentation speech on the floor of the National Assembly, where he highlighted areas the budget would affect.
DAILY POST had earlier reported that Buhari will today present the 2018 Appropriation Bill to a joint session of the National Assembly.
The 2018 budget, if passed by the National Assembly, the Federal Government will be spending about N8 .6 trillion in 2018, which is a jump of about 15 per cent from the N7.44 trillion budgeted for the current year.
President Buhari said the Government is committed to development of every region of the country and continuing the ease of doing business in Nigeria.
He pointed out that huge contracts and liability were inherited from past governments and that contractors were being owed on major projects.
According to him, the N8 .6 trillion 2018 budget will be used to see that these issues are solved within the next one year.
The President mentioned several roads from all parts of the country that would be constructed and rehabilitated before his government winds down.

Researchers continue to discover the many health benefits fruit has to offer. Fruit protects cells from the destruction caused by free radicals and provides protection against degenerative diseases that attack the bloodstream, organs, tissues and membranes. Components in fruit support your immune and digestive systems as well as helping with elimination of wastes. Whether you are young, old, dieting or health conscious, fruit offers you more than just something delicious to eat. Phytochemicals All plant foods, including fruit, contain compounds called phytochemicals or phytonutrients, which provide powerful health benefits. Two main types of phytochemicals found in fruit are flavonoids and carotenoids. The University of Michigan Health System reports flavonoids, found in fruits such as cherries and red grapes, contain anthocyanins that help fight against heart disease and offer anti-inflammatory and anticancer protection.
